The Harsh Medieval Fantasy Setting of Elvensang
Forget gleaming spires and benevolent wizards. The Worlaix Elvensang universe is inspired by the grit and grime of early medieval times. This is a medieval elf game where fantasy is a subtle, often dangerous spice, not the main course. Magic exists, but it’s rare, mistrusted, and often comes with a terrible cost. Elves aren’t revered guardians of the forest here; they’re scorned, seen as strange relics or outright threats by the human majority.
The environment is a character in itself. From dank taverns buzzing with hostile gossip to gloomy forests hiding very real dangers, every location reinforces the protagonist’s precarious place in society. The recently updated Episode 5 amplifies this immersion with over 45 unique artworks and stunning new backgrounds that make this world feel lived-in and tangible. The hand-drawn graphics aren’t just pretty—they’re mood-setters, painting every scene with a palette of tension, melancholy, or fleeting hope. Combined with a thoughtful, immersive soundscape, you don’t just play this elf visual novel; you feel its chill and its rare, cherished warmth. 🍂🕯️
How Your Choices Shape the Elf Protagonist’s Fate
This is where Elvensang truly becomes your story. The Elvensang choices you make aren’t about picking a polite or rude dialogue option; they’re moral compass settings in a world with no clear north. Will you cling to the kindness your mother taught you, even as the world rewards cruelty? Or will you let bitterness take root, using cunning and malice to carve out your place?
I learned this the hard way. Early on, you’re tasked with investigating the kin of some haughty acquaintances. A simple fetch quest, right? Wrong. My choices during that investigation sparked a chain of rivalries and alliances that echoed into later chapters, closing off one potential romance path entirely while deepening another. It was a brutal lesson: in Elvensang, there are rarely “right” answers, only consequential ones.
The narrative branches are extensive. There’s a mandatory, deeply woven “vanilla” romance with Sunny—a connection that serves as the emotional bedrock of the Elvensang story. But beyond that, optional side romances and specific narrative kinks allow you to tailor the protagonist’s journey, leading to vastly different outcomes and endings. My practical advice? Save often and replay bravely. Your first playthrough should be instinctive—live with your decisions. Then, go back. Choose differently. You’ll be stunned by how another path can reveal hidden facets of characters and entirely new story beats.
To help visualize the scope of your agency, here’s a breakdown of the core mechanics driving the Elvensang story:
| Mechanic | Description | Player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Dynamic Choice System | Decisions that alter character relationships, plot trajectories, and unlock unique scenes. Choices often have delayed consequences. | Directly controls the narrative branch, leading to multiple endings and deeply personalized story arcs. |
| Relationship Values | A hidden metric tracking affinity with key characters, influenced by dialogue, gifts, and actions during events. | Determines availability of romance paths, the tone of interactions, and which characters become allies or rivals. |
| Exploration & Investigation | Interactive points in environments that reveal world lore, character backstories, and crucial clues for plot progression. | Unlocks additional context, provides advantages in future dilemmas, and can uncover secret story elements. |
Key Characters and Their Impact on Elvensang Narrative
The soul of any great elf visual novel is its cast, and Elvensang delivers characters who feel heartbreakingly real. Our half-elf protagonist is a masterpiece of silent writing—his personality is shaped entirely by your Elvensang choices, making his triumphs and despairs feel uniquely yours.
Then there’s Sunny. The recent Episode 5 update included a full sprite rework for her, and it’s more than a graphical glow-up. It captures the subtle evolution of her character—her resilience, her hidden vulnerabilities, and the strength of her connection to you. Her romance is the canonical heart of the story, a beacon of genuine affection in the gloom. As the developers themselves emphasize, this is a narrative driven by depth, not diversion:
“Sunny’s relationship is the anchor of the protagonist’s emotional journey. We built the Elvensang story from that core outward, prioritizing character development and impactful choices. This is a story first, where every element serves the characters and their complex world.”
But the web of connection extends far beyond. From potential friends who might become lovers (or bitter enemies) to arrogant nobles whose kin you might investigate, every interaction is charged with potential. Rivalries simmer and boil over based on your actions. A careless word in Episode 2 can mean a missing ally in Episode 5. This intricate character web ensures the Worlaix Elvensang experience is densely layered and rich with replay value.
